Discover cheap things to do in Macau

Macau is a paradise of affordable experiences, perfect for discerning travellers seeking value without sacrificing quality. Begin your adventure at the iconic Ruins of St. Paul's, a stunning façade that remains a symbol of the city, offering a free glimpse into Macau's rich history. Just a short stroll away, the vibrant Senado Square bursts with colour and charm, where you can wander the cobbled streets and admire the Portuguese architecture while enjoying free live performances during festivals. For those looking to indulge their taste buds, head to the Rua do Cunha in Taipa, where you’ll find an array of budget-friendly eateries serving up delicious local snacks like pork chop buns and egg tarts. The Macau Museum, housed in a 16th-century fort, offers an affordable entry fee to explore the fascinating fusion of cultures that defines this unique city. Finally, consider staying in the lively Cotai area, which boasts a variety of budget hotels that provide convenient access to these attractions while ensuring a comfortable stay, complete with attentive service to pamper your family. With its mix of culture, cuisine, and hospitality, Macau is a destination where quality and affordability meet.

When is the best time for a budget trip to Macau?
Weather is probably a major factor when you plan your trip to Macau, but bear in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 29°C, while the coldest months are January and December, with an average of 18°C. The rainiest months in Macau are August, June, July and September, with each month seeing an average of 338 mm of rainfall.

How can I get to Macau and get around on a budget?
Scoping out the transportation options in Macau can help keep you on budget. The closest airport is 3.5 mi (5.6 km) from the centre in Macau (MFM-Macau Intl.). However, if that doesn't suit your budget, you can look into flights to Zhuhai (ZUH-Jinwan), which is 17.8 mi (28.6 km) away. Head over to Barra Station to catch the metro.
